Geocache Description:

Not busy on February 12th??? Come join us for Breakfast! We are returning to Lake Towsen Park in beautiful Hernando County. You will remember this as the site of the wildly successful Nature Coast GeoEvent last summer.


The meet and greet will run from 9:00 to Noon. Isonzo Karst will have their world famous Withlacoochee State Forest cache maps on display. Not to mention the Power of Yo!

We will supply some bagels, fruit, coffee, and juice. Please bring your favorite breakfast fare. Remember, SUGAR is one of the Basic Food Groups for Geocachers. We are also providing the pavilion, ice filled barrels (bring your own beverages), paper plates and plastic utensils.

When you post your note, please let us know if you will be bringing some goodies.

This event is TB friendly, although there are plenty of Bug-sized caches in the area to place them in.

Coordinates are for the turn off CR 476, there's a new, small, brown sign indicating the park entry 500 feet. Park does have a nice playground, volleyball court, restrooms, hiking trails into the woods and to the lake and is adjacent to the paved Withlacoochee State Trail. Good road and off road biking with caches available. No dogs, no alcohol allowed in Hernando County parks.

Please keep in mind December 6 thru March 13 is small game season (bobcat, fox, raccoon) in the Croom section of the forest. Although most hunters are out (w/leashed dogs) at dawn or dusk, it is still a good idea to wear bright clothing.
